Crucial Element to Consist Of in a Funeral Service Program
When producing a funeral program, it's necessary to include key elements that recognize the deceased and overview guests with the solution.
Begin with the complete name of the individual that passed away, together with their birth and death days. Include a touching obituary that captures their life story, success, and interests.
Next, describe the service's order, detailing each section-- like readings, music, and eulogies-- so attendees understand what to expect.
Including an individual touch, such as a favorite quote or rhyme, can give convenience.
Lastly, take into consideration consisting of a thanks area to reveal gratitude for those that supported the family members during this challenging time.
These components develop a thoughtful homage, helping everybody celebrate the life lived.

Dos and Do n'ts of Funeral Program Rules
Browsing funeral program decorum can feel overwhelming, however following a few simple dos and do n'ts can aid guarantee you recognize the dead properly.
Do consist of the full name, dates, and a picture of the deceased. Share individual tales or quotes that show their character. Maintain the tone considerate and helpful.
Do not overload the program with way too much text. Stay clear of utilizing informal language or wit, as it might come off as ill-mannered. Avoid talking about debatable topics or personal complaints, as this isn't the time or area.
Lastly, do not fail to remember to check! Typos can detract from the program's sentiment.
